How do you handle a situation when you realize a passenger has had to much alcohol and is requesting more? ✔✔I'm sorry sir but you've met her limit so I can get you a soda if you like.

What would you do if a passenger was allowing their child to run up and down the aisles and
other passengers were complaining? ✔✔I would kneel down beside parents and be as discreet as
possible and let them know I was going to need to have them talk to their child about on remaining in his Cdue to being distractive other passengers as well as it is a safety issue.
Tell me about a time you persuaded someone to see your point of view or try something new. ✔✔I found it's always best to ask someone to explain their point of you first then repeat it back
to them to confirm if they agree with what I'm hearing then make a suggestion that would be more accommodating to the situation or my point you people tend to listen to you more once they feel you understand them
What would you do if the captain had turned on the fasten seatbelt sign, and a child was sleeping not the floor in front of the parents and they did not want to wake up the child and put home in a
seatbelt. ✔✔I would kneel down beside the parents inside and let them know their child is going
to have to be in a seatbelt due to safety concerns that children are frequently her if they're not in
restraints and we wouldn't want that to happen to their child as well it is it is the airlines policy due to that reason

What do you do if the captain has turned on the fasten seatbelt sign, told everyone to sit. Including the f/a because of Severe turbulence and there is a passenger who has gotten up from
his seat? ✔✔I would remind the passenger that the captain has fasten the seatbelt sign and that
it's very it's not safe to be walking around that I need them to to return to their seats
